UserSplit Cutover Drift: the extracted account service and the legacy Marigold monolith user module are reporting divergent record counts during dual-write. This fires when drift exceeds 0.5% over 15 minutes. New team members should not replay writes manually. Reconciliation steps and the rollback procedure are documented on the internal page.

wiki page, tajog-fafog: https://gitlab.paliqsys.corp/dash/display/job/853dd6fcbf54

### Ticket: Font vendoring drifted again on Lintbarrow staging

So the vendored font bundle on staging no longer matches what's pinned in the repo — someone hot-patched the glyph set directly on the box. Build output now differs between environments. Can you eyeball the diff before I re-pin? Staging is currently running with these values.

deployment values, kajep-kageg:
[praix]
host = praix.paliqcorp.corp
user = praix_svc
database = praix_prod

**Postmortem timeline — 14:05**

The Stringloom extraction script began dropping pluralized keys after a refactor merged that morning. For context (new folks): Stringloom scans our codebase nightly and pushes translatable strings to the localization queue. The dropped keys meant translators saw nothing new for six languages. On-call noticed the queue flatline at 14:05 and rolled back within twenty minutes. The first run that reproduced the drop is below.

build token for bajog-yaduf: htk9_39788324c